Mouse Ear Falls, Tennessee (#AT0011)


   Oops, I've gotten us lost!  To see Mouse Ear Falls you would have to leave the Appalachian Trail and "blue blaze it" for a number of miles (or take side trail marked by blue blazes, rather that the white blazes of the A.T.).  The falls is in a remote and beautiful part of the park's backcountry, not far from Walnut Basin.  There are more than 900 miles of backcountry trails within the Great Smoky Mountains National Park.
